Score 94/100 · Drink 2027-2035, Antonio Galloni, Vinous, Jan 2026

The 2015 Pinot Noir Meredith Estate, tasted from magnum, has aged well. It's a powerful, deep wine that reflects the rich, extracted style of the day in its potent, dark-toned fruit and copious new French oak. Macerated dark cherry fruit, tobacco, cedar and espresso turn up the intensity quite a bit. The 2015 is a very good wine, but I must say I prefer the current style here.

Score 95/100 · Drink 2018-2032, Lisa Perrotti-Brown MW, Wine Advocate, Apr 2018

Medium to deep ruby-purple in color, the 2015 Pinot Noir Meredith Estate opens with pronounced black raspberries, black cherries and violets scents with touches of chocolate box, anise, black soil and oolong tea plus a touch of cinnamon stick. Medium to full-bodied with a firm foundation of grainy tannins and lively freshness, it has a wonderfully expressive core of black berries and floral notions, finishing with great persistence. 1,335 cases produced.
